I have always been interested in tattoos. I wanted to have one but I have not decided yet on which part of my body will the tattoo be on and have not chosen a design yet. I need to have a thorough research first on what design would best suit my personality before finally having one. I don't want to have a tattoo that is very hard to conceal. We cannot ignore the fact that there are times that we do not want our tattoo to be seen by everyone. But I want my tattoo also to be in the part of my body where I could easily brag whenever I want to. Woman as I am, I want my tattoo to be in a body part that would make it look sexy and glowing. And with all those things to be considered, I finally decided to have a lower back tattoo. Having a lower back tattoo would be the best for women who wants a tattoo that could easily be hidden and shown as well as it would look sexy and vibrant.

After deciding on which part should my tattoo be, it is now time to choose the tattoo design for lower back tattoo. Lots of tattoo designs are available for me to choose from. For the lower back tattoo, the size should be just right. Not too small and not too large. It should be a tattoo design that would emphasize the bend of my back and would enhance the curves oh my hips. I have gone through the many tattoo designs but my attention was caught by a butterfly design. I think it is perfect for a lower back tattoo and suits my personality. I can only imagine how the body of the butterfly would fit in the bend of my back and those beautiful wings extending to both sides of my hips enhancing the curves of my hips. I need to be decided on having a lower back tattoo because I will be living with this for the rest of my life.

I decided to have the butterfly design but I need to have it be personalized. I had the light lines instead of the broad lines and reduced the wings to fit it perfectly in my body. The artist made a draft of the tattoo design I have chosen on my back before finally doing it. When I saw it, I loved the design and decided to finally do my lower back tattoo. I was optimistic of the result.

A few weeks after I got my tattoo, some of my best girlfriends and I went to the club one night. I wore a shirt that was short enough to d but my new lower back tattoo. It seemed almost right away I started getting compliments on it from guys and girls. I was asked often where I got it done and who came up with the design. I explained how I had went through the process of choosing the position on the lower back and how I went through many tatoo designs before making my final choice. I also explained how I had the tattoo artist customize the design to suit me. It was funny how many people didn't know that you could have tattoo design changed to suit your tastes. After that night I felt so good about getting my lower back tattoo. It works for me during the day when I can cover it up at work and it is fun to show it off at night when I go out. I am so glad that I took the time to think through my tattoo instead of just going out and getting the first good tattoo design I saw. This is definitely one of the best decisions that I have made and one I am extremely happy to live with.
